- Written Answers — Tax Code: Tax Code (29 Jun 2005)
Brian Cowen: A stamp duty exemption for first time buyers of second hand houses under â¬317,500 was brought in by budget 2005. Previously it had applied only to houses up to â¬190,500, so the significant increase in the threshold made this exemption relevant to a much broader range of purchasers. - Written Answers — Tax Yield: Tax Yield (29 Jun 2005)
Brian Cowen: The following are the VAT receipts received by the Exchequer for each of the years 2003 and 2004 and for the first five months of 2005: Year â'¬m 2003 9,721 2004 10,693 2005 (to end-May) 5,534 The budgeted forecast for VAT receipts in 2005 is â¬11.625 billion.
- Written Answers — Tax Yield: Tax Yield (29 Jun 2005)
Brian Cowen: The following are the capital gains tax receipts received by the Exchequer for each of the years 2003 and 2004 and for the first five months of 2005: â'¬m 2003 1,443 2004 1,516 2005 (to end-May) 538 The budgeted forecast for capital gains tax receipts in 2005 is â¬1.5 billion.
- Written Answers — Tax Yield: Tax Yield (29 Jun 2005)
Brian Cowen: The following are the income tax receipts received by the Exchequer for each of the years 2003 and 2004 and for the first five months of 2005: â'¬m 2003 9,162 2004 10,651 2005 (to end-May) 4,035 The budgeted forecast for income tax receipts in 2005 is â¬11.105 billion.
- Written Answers — Tax Yield: Tax Yield (29 Jun 2005)
Brian Cowen: The following are the capital acquisitions tax receipts received by the Exchequer for each of the years 2003 and 2004 and for the first five months of 2005: â'¬m 2003 214 2004 190 2005 (to end-May) 98 The budgeted forecast for capital acquisitions tax receipts in 2005 is â¬180 million.

- Written Answers — Tax Yield: Tax Yield (29 Jun 2005)
Brian Cowen: I am advised by the Revenue Commissioners that the revenue received in respect of vehicle registration tax for all motor vehicles is as follows: â'¬m 2003 819 2004 946 2005 (to end-May) 677 The VRT receipts for the year 2005 are estimated at â¬1.039 billion.
